To begin with, it's essential to choose tiles with complementary tones and textures. When transitioning from, say, a kitchen to a living room, selecting tiles with coordinating colors can promote a visual harmony. For instance, pairing a neutral-toned kitchen backsplash with similarly toned floor tiles in the living room ensures a seamless transition. Another technique involves using border tiles or smaller mosaic designs. These elements can serve as a bridge between different tile patterns or types, adding a unique touch to your interior design. Border tiles can subtly indicate a transition while maintaining the ‘seamless’ look. Whether you’re shifting from a ceramic tile in the bathroom to a porcelain tile in the hallway, these transitional tiles can create continuity without stark changes. Texture plays a crucial role in transitioning tile types. By keeping the texture consistent, you can mix different tile materials without disrupting the visual flow. For instance, blending a glossy ceramic tile with a matte stone tile can still look cohesive if the textures and finishes complement each other. Consider also the impact of grout lines. The color and width of grout lines can either unite different tile types or create an intentional distinction between spaces. Opting for a neutral grout color that matches both tile types can help unify the areas while reducing visual interruptions. Lighting is another important factor to consider when transitioning tile types. Adequate lighting can highlight the seamless connection between tiles, drawing attention to the design rather than the transition itself. In areas where natural light is limited, strategic placement of light fixtures can enhance the appearance of your tiles, making transitions less noticeable and more integrated.
